Understanding the signs you need professional electrical repair is essential for maintaining a safe and functional home. When homeowners notice irregularities such as frequent circuit breaker trips, flickering lights, or outlets that refuse to work, these are common indicators that something may be wrong with the electrical system. These issues often point to underlying problems like overloaded circuits, faulty wiring, or aging components that require expert attention. Recognizing these warning signs early can help prevent more serious damage or safety hazards, making it important to seek assistance from experienced electrical contractors who can diagnose and resolve the issues effectively.

The signs you need professional electrical repair are often connected to specific problems or plans within a property. For example, if switches or outlets are warm to the touch, it may signal loose connections or overloaded circuits that need immediate attention. Similarly, persistent power outages or dimming lights can indicate issues with the electrical supply or wiring system. These problems are common in homes undergoing renovations, expansions, or electrical upgrades, where existing wiring may not meet current demands. Addressing these signs promptly ensures that electrical systems operate safely and efficiently, especially when planning major projects like adding new outlets, installing dedicated circuits, or upgrading panels.

Typical properties where signs you need professional electrical repair come up include older homes, residential buildings, and commercial spaces. Older houses often have outdated wiring that can pose safety risks, while newer properties may experience problems due to improper installation or electrical load issues. Commercial properties with high electrical demands, such as retail stores or offices, are also prone to electrical signs that require professional intervention. What are common signs of electrical issues in a home? Indicators include frequent circuit breaker trips, flickering lights, or outlets that don't work properly, which suggest the need for professional electrical repair services from local contractors.

Why do electrical outlets sometimes stop working? Outlets may fail due to worn-out wiring, loose connections, or underlying electrical faults that require a trained electrician to diagnose and repair.

What does it mean if circuit breakers frequently trip? Repeated breaker trips can indicate overloaded circuits, short circuits, or other wiring problems best handled by experienced electrical repair service providers.

When should I be concerned about burning smells or sparks near outlets? Burning odors or sparks are signs of serious electrical faults that should be addressed promptly by qualified electrical repair professionals to prevent hazards.
